本文目录导读:
随着信息技术的不断发展,Excel文件在企业办公中的应用越来越广泛,在众多数据处理工具中,PHPExcel以其强大的功能、灵活的操作和良好的兼容性受到了广大开发者的青睐,本文将深入剖析PHPExcel技术,详细介绍如何将Excel文件保存至服务器。
PHPExcel简介
PHPExcel是一个开源的PHP库,用于生成和读取Excel文件,它支持多种Excel文件格式,如Excel 97-2003(.xls)、Excel 2007及以上(.xlsx)等,通过PHPExcel,开发者可以轻松地实现Excel文件的创建、编辑、保存和读取等功能。
二、PHPExcel保存文件至服务器的实现步骤
图片来源于网络,如有侵权联系删除
1、引入PHPExcel库
需要在项目中引入PHPExcel库,可以通过以下代码实现:
require_once 'PHPExcel.php';
2、创建PHPExcel对象
通过以下代码创建PHPExcel对象:
$objPHPExcel = new PHPExcel();
3、设置工作表
创建工作表可以通过以下代码实现:
$sheet = $objPHPExcel->getActiveSheet();
4、填充数据
根据实际需求,填充工作表中的数据。
图片来源于网络,如有侵权联系删除
$sheet->setCellValue('A1', '姓名'); $sheet->setCellValue('B1', '年龄'); $sheet->setCellValue('A2', '张三'); $sheet->setCellValue('B2', '25');
5、设置文件名
为生成的Excel文件设置文件名,如下所示:
$filename = 'example.xlsx';
6、保存文件至服务器
将Excel文件保存至服务器,可以使用以下代码:
$objWriter = PHPExcel_IOFactory::createWriter($objPHPExcel, 'Excel2007'); $objWriter->save($filename);
至此,Excel文件已成功保存至服务器。
注意事项
1、服务器环境
确保服务器已安装PHP和PHPExcel库,若未安装,请先安装相关环境。
2、文件路径
图片来源于网络,如有侵权联系删除
在保存文件时,确保指定了正确的文件路径,否则,可能导致文件无法保存或保存至错误位置。
3、文件权限
在服务器上,确保保存文件的目录具有相应的读写权限。
4、文件名
在设置文件名时,避免使用特殊字符或中文,以免影响文件保存。
通过本文的详细解析,相信大家对PHPExcel保存文件至服务器的方法有了更深入的了解,在实际开发过程中,灵活运用PHPExcel技术,可以高效地处理Excel文件,提高工作效率,希望本文对您有所帮助。
标签: #phpexcel保存文件到服务器
评论列表